CVE-2022-41814 describes a Cross-site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the BlueSpiceFoundation extension for BlueSpice wikis. An authenticated user with edit permissions can inject arbitrary HTML into the history view of a wikipage. This medium-severity vulnerability (CVSS 5.4) has a low attack complexity and requires user interaction, potentially leading to limited impact on confidentiality and integrity. Currently, there is no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), or significant community discussion or media coverage.
